Comments:
Parts of the poem from Philips' Happyness ('Nature courts Happiness, although it be'); La Grandeur d'esprit (A chosen Privacy, a cheap Content'); 'Mr. Francis Finch , the Excellent Palæmon' ('This is confest Presumption, for had I') Thomas (1990) I: 143-5, 157-9, 188-90.
